+//! Container traits for extra
+
+use std::container::Mutable;
+
+/// A double-ended sequence that allows querying, insertion and deletion at both ends.
+pub trait Deque<T> : Mutable {
+    /// Provide a reference to the front element, or None if the sequence is empty
+    fn front<'a>(&'a self) -> Option<&'a T>;
+
+    /// Provide a mutable reference to the front element, or None if the sequence is empty
+    fn front_mut<'a>(&'a mut self) -> Option<&'a mut T>;
+
+    /// Provide a reference to the back element, or None if the sequence is empty
+    fn back<'a>(&'a self) -> Option<&'a T>;
+
+    /// Provide a mutable reference to the back element, or None if the sequence is empty
+    fn back_mut<'a>(&'a mut self) -> Option<&'a mut T>;
+
+    /// Insert an element first in the sequence
+    fn push_front(&mut self, elt: T);
+
+    /// Insert an element last in the sequence
+    fn push_back(&mut self, elt: T);
+
+    /// Remove the last element and return it, or None if the sequence is empty
+    fn pop_back(&mut self) -> Option<T>;
+
+    /// Remove the first element and return it, or None if the sequence is empty
+    fn pop_front(&mut self) -> Option<T>;
+}
